 By:   Wedge   (Member)

There was an established palette and energy that was common to many (if not most) action films of the era. What Shirley added to TURBULENCE was intricate thematic development -- in particular, her wicked deconstruction of "Carol of the Bells" -- along with her typically brilliant orchestration; Shirley had a rare gift for sustained action writing that never becomes muddled or taxing to the ear. With TURBULENCE, she also took the time and effort to realize much of the score's synth percussion and the like live on the scoring stage, alongside the rest of the orchestra.
